Johannesburg water invites quotations for the supply and delivery of sg42 shouldered pipe collars (110mm and 160mm) for high-impact mpvc pipes, targeting smmes that are 51% or more black-owned. This request for quotation (RFQ 6000080437) is open to csd-registered suppliers and closes on 28 may 2026 at 12:00pm.

Johannesburg Water invites quotations for the supply and delivery of pipe collars (110mm and 160mm SG42 shouldered, high-impact MPVC) to various depots. The tender uses the 80/20 preferential procurement scoring system, with a strong focus on empowering 51%+ black-owned SMMEs. Submission is mandatory via the National Treasury eTender Portal.

Submission Guidelines
Source: 6000080437 Supply and delivery of pipe collars .pdfSubmit your quotation via the National Treasury eTender Portal (https://www.etenders.gov.za/). Steps: search for Johannesburg Water, use RFQ reference 6000080437, log in with CSD credentials, and follow the submission checklist. Late submissions will not be accepted. Compulsory returnables: valid Tax Clearance Certificate/SARS PIN, certified/original/valid B-BBEE certificate or compliant sworn affidavit, municipal rates/taxes statement (≤90 days in arrears), MBD 4 (Declaration of Interest), MBD 8 (Past SCM Practices), MBD 9 (Independent Bid Determination), CSD registration proof, MBD 6.1 (Preference Points Claim), company registration documents with director/shareholder ID copies. Quotations must be on company letterhead, in PDF format only, and include manufacturer datasheets and brand names for all items. Total quotation value must include all applicable taxes. Acceptance is subject to Johannesburg Water’s Supply Chain Policy.
Evaluation Criteria
Source: 6000080437 Supply and delivery of pipe collars .pdfEvaluation uses the 80/20 point system: 80 points for price, 20 points for specific goals (SMME: EME or QSE, 51%+ black-owned by Black People). Mandatory pass/fail criteria: must be CSD-registered; not listed on National Treasury’s Database of Restricted Suppliers or Register for Tender Defaulters; no directors convicted of fraud/corruption in the past 5 years; no municipal rates/taxes in arrears >90 days; not blacklisted for non-performance. Failure to submit required documents (e.g., B-BBEE certificate, tax clearance) will result in disqualification or zero scoring for preference points.
Technical Specifications
Source: 6000080437 Supply and delivery of pipe collars .pdfSupply and deliver pipe collars for Johannesburg Water. Items: PIPE COLLAR 110MM SG42 SHOULDERED FOR 110MM HIGH IMPACT MPVC PIPE (Material 1078, Qty: 200 EA) and PIPE COLLAR 160MM SG42 SHOULDERED FOR 160MM HIGH IMPACT MPVC PIPE (Material 1077, Qty: 200 EA, with additional quantities of 100 EA and 150 EA listed). Standards: SG42 shouldered, high-impact MPVC pipe. Mandatory: Provide manufacturer datasheets and brand names for all items; failure results in disqualification. Quotation must include all applicable taxes.
Financial Requirements
Source: 6000080437 Supply and delivery of pipe collars .pdfTotal quotation value must be inclusive of all applicable taxes (e.g., VAT). Failure to include taxes leads to disqualification. No bid bonds, guarantees, or payment terms are specified. Pricing must follow the provided schedule (per item, with UOM and Qty).
Compliance Requirements
Source: 6000080437 Supply and delivery of pipe collars .pdfMandatory: CSD registration (proof required), valid Tax Clearance Certificate/SARS PIN, valid B-BBEE certificate or compliant sworn affidavit (non-compliant affidavits score zero). Specific goal: SMME (EME/QSE) 51%+ black-owned by Black People (20 preference points). Additional compulsory documents: municipal rates/taxes statement (≤90 days in arrears), MBD 4 (Declaration of Interest), MBD 8 (Past SCM Practices), MBD 9 (Independent Bid Determination), MBD 6.1 (Preference Points Claim), company registration documents with director/shareholder IDs. Exclusions: No bids from persons in state service, blacklisted suppliers, or those with past fraud/corruption convictions. Quotations must be on company letterhead and in PDF format. Subject to PPPFA 2000, its regulations, and GCC.
